Macron Pledges to Raise Issue of Armenian Prisoners Held in Azerbaijan with Aliyev

French President Emmanuel Macron, speaking on the sidelines of the 8th European Political Community (EPC) Summit in Yerevan, pledged to personally raise the issue of Armenian prisoners held in Azerbaijan with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ev, telling reporters that he intends to coordinate with the Armenian leadership before deciding on the format of those talks.

“First, I will discuss this with the President and Prime Minister of Armenia. After that, I will call President Aliyev, and together we will work out the appropriate format for further action, either in person or through that phone call,” Macron said in response to a question from a NEWS.am correspondent. “You can count on me. I deeply believe in this peace process.”
